Abstract

The utility model discloses a screw conveyor, which comprises a U-shaped shell; the top of the shell is provided with an odor suction hole and an inspection hole, the top of the left end of the shell is provided with a feed inlet, the left end of the shell is provided with a speed reducer, and the left end of the speed reducer is connected with a power device; a discharge hole is formed in the lower side of the right end of the shell; a water accumulation bin is arranged at the lower part of the shell, a flushing water inlet is arranged at the upper end of the water accumulation bin, a water outlet is arranged at the lower end of the water accumulation bin, and an access hole is formed in the side surface of the water accumulation bin; the inner cavity of the shell is provided with a spiral sheet, the spiral sheet is connected with a speed reducer through a connecting shaft, and the lower part of the inner cavity is provided with a lining plate. The utility model adopts totally enclosed mechanized operation, the material will not overflow, reduce the air pollution; the odor suction hole is arranged, so that odor can be timely discharged; and a draining and filtering function is arranged, so that solid and liquid are separated in time, and back-end processing equipment is built.

Description

Screw conveyer
Technical Field
The utility model relates to conveying and solid-liquid separation treatment equipment, in particular to a screw conveyor.
Background
Along with the development of urbanization, the scales of hotels, hotels and dining halls are gradually enlarged, the water content of kitchen waste, kitchen waste and sludge is very high, and the kitchen waste, the kitchen waste and the sludge are easy to rot and smell if the sewage is not separated. But the operation of the existing extrusion equipment and squeezing equipment is blocked and seriously abraded, and the existing extrusion equipment and squeezing equipment can not continuously feed, squeeze and discharge materials continuously, so that the screw conveyor not only can effectively squeeze and separate solid and liquid of the materials, but also adopts totally enclosed mechanized continuous operation, and avoids the phenomena of running, falling, dripping and leakage.

Detailed Description
The present invention will be described in detail with reference to the following preferred embodiments.
The screw conveyor shown in fig. 1 includes a U-shaped housing; the top of the shell is provided with an odor suction hole and an inspection hole, the top of the left end of the shell is provided with a feed inlet, the left end of the shell is provided with a speed reducer, and the left end of the speed reducer is connected with a power device; a discharge hole is formed in the lower side of the right end of the shell; a water accumulation bin is arranged at the lower part of the shell, a flushing water inlet is arranged at the upper end of the water accumulation bin, a water outlet is arranged at the lower end of the water accumulation bin, and an access hole is formed in the side surface of the water accumulation bin; the inner cavity of the shell is provided with a spiral sheet, the spiral sheet is connected with a speed reducer through a connecting shaft, and the lower part of the inner cavity is provided with a lining plate; a plurality of water outlet holes are formed in the lining plate; a blank board is arranged at the top of the inspection opening; a blank board is arranged outside the access hole.
The shell is made of carbon steel plates or stainless steel plates, materials enter the screw conveyor from the feeding hole, sewage flows out from the bottom, the purpose of solid-liquid separation is achieved, and the materials after solid-liquid separation are discharged from the discharging hole.
